运动控制器一般用什么编程

worktile 其他 4

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    运动控制器一般使用什么编程语言?

    运动控制器是一种用于控制机械设备运动的设备,它通常配备了一个编程接口,以便用户可以通过编程来实现对设备的控制。那么,运动控制器一般使用什么编程语言呢?

    答案是,运动控制器使用的编程语言通常是高级编程语言,例如C、C++、C#、Python等。这些编程语言具有丰富的功能和灵活的语法,可以满足对运动控制器的复杂控制需求。

    在运动控制器编程中,常见的操作包括设置运动参数、控制运动轴的运动、读取传感器数据、处理逻辑判断等。使用高级编程语言可以方便地实现这些操作,提高编程效率和可维护性。

    此外,一些运动控制器还提供了专门的编程接口或开发工具包,以便用户更方便地进行编程。这些接口和工具包通常提供了一些封装好的函数和类,用于简化编程过程,提供更高层次的抽象,减少编程的复杂性。

    总之,运动控制器一般使用高级编程语言进行编程,这样可以实现对设备的复杂控制,并提高编程效率和可维护性。对于不同的运动控制器,可能会有不同的编程语言选择,用户可以根据自己的需求和熟悉程度选择适合的编程语言来进行开发。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    运动控制器一般使用的编程语言包括:

    1. C/C++:C/C++是一种常用的编程语言,广泛用于嵌入式系统和控制器编程。C/C++具有高效性和可靠性,适用于实时控制和运动控制应用。

    2. PLC编程语言:PLC(可编程逻辑控制器)是一种常用的工业控制设备,用于自动化和运动控制。PLC编程语言包括梯形图、指令列表、结构化文本和功能块图等,用于编写逻辑控制程序。

    3. LabVIEW:LabVIEW是一种图形化编程语言,用于控制和测量应用。LabVIEW的特点是易于学习和使用,适用于运动控制器的开发和调试。

    4. MATLAB/Simulink:MATLAB和Simulink是一种流行的科学计算和建模仿真工具,广泛用于运动控制器的设计和开发。MATLAB提供了丰富的数学和信号处理函数,Simulink则用于建立系统模型和进行仿真。

    5. Python:Python是一种简单易学的脚本语言,具有丰富的库和模块,适用于控制和数据处理。Python在运动控制器中的应用越来越广泛,尤其是在机器人控制和自动化领域。

    需要注意的是,不同的运动控制器可能使用不同的编程语言,具体的选择取决于控制器的硬件平台和应用需求。此外,还可以使用其他编程语言如Java、VB.NET等进行运动控制器的编程,根据具体情况选择最合适的语言。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    运动控制器一般使用专门的编程语言和软件进行编程。常见的编程语言包括C、C++、Python等,而常见的软件包括LabVIEW、MATLAB、MotionPerfect等。

    下面将以LabVIEW和C++为例,分别介绍运动控制器的编程方法和操作流程。

    一、LabVIEW编程

    LabVIEW是一种图形化编程语言,可以用于控制和监测运动控制器。下面是LabVIEW编程的操作流程:

    1. 安装LabVIEW软件并打开。

    2. 创建新的项目,并选择合适的运动控制器模块。

    3. 在界面中添加所需的控件和指示器,如按钮、滑块、图表等。

    4. 使用函数模块和线连接控件和指示器,实现所需的运动控制功能。

    5. 编写运动控制的算法和逻辑,如位置控制、速度控制等。

    6. 运行程序进行测试,查看控制效果。

    7. 调试和优化程序,确保运动控制的稳定性和准确性。

    二、C++编程

    C++是一种常用的编程语言,可以用于编写高性能的运动控制程序。下面是C++编程的操作流程:

    1. 安装C++编译器并打开开发环境,如Visual Studio。

    2. 创建新的项目,并选择合适的运动控制器库文件。

    3. 在源代码文件中编写运动控制的相关代码,包括初始化控制器、设置参数、执行运动指令等。

    4. 编译源代码生成可执行文件。

    5. 运行程序进行测试,查看控制效果。

    6. 调试和优化程序,确保运动控制的稳定性和准确性。

    综上所述,运动控制器的编程方法和操作流程主要包括选择合适的编程语言和软件、添加控件和指示器、编写运动控制算法、运行程序进行测试、调试和优化程序等步骤。具体的编程方法和操作流程可以根据实际情况和需求进行调整和修改。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部